What Is WordPress Migration?

WordPress migration is moving your website from one hosting provider to another or from one version of WordPress to another. This can be a complex and time-consuming process involving the transfer of files, databases, and settings from one server to another. While it is possible to do it yourself, using a professional WordPress migration service is recommended to ensure that the process is done correctly and efficiently.

Why Opt for WordPress Migration Services

There are several reasons why you should opt for WordPress migration services:

1. Improved Website Performance

One of the main reasons to migrate your WordPress website is to improve its performance. A slow website can frustrate users and negatively impact your search engine rankings. You can improve your website’s speed, uptime, and overall performance by migrating to a faster and more reliable hosting provider.

2. Enhanced Security

WordPress is a popular platform, which makes it a target for hackers and cybercriminals. If your website is not properly secured, it can be vulnerable to attacks that can compromise your data and damage your reputation. By migrating to a more secure hosting provider or updating to a newer version of WordPress, you can improve your website’s security and protect it from potential threats.

3. Access to New Features and Functionality

WordPress constantly evolves, with new features and functionality added with each update. By migrating to a newer version of WordPress, you can take advantage of these new features and improve your website’s functionality. This can help you stay competitive in your industry and provide a better user experience for your visitors.

4. Better Customer Support

If you are experiencing issues with your current hosting provider, you may find that their customer support is not up to par. You can access better customer support and technical assistance by migrating to a new hosting provider. This can be especially important if you are not technically proficient and need help with troubleshooting or maintenance.

5. Cost Savings

If your current hosting provider is charging you a high fee for their services, you may be able to save money by migrating to a more affordable provider. By shopping around and comparing prices, you can find a hosting provider that offers the features and functionality you need at a price that fits your budget.
